Traditional folk dance music piece known in North Cyprus as Çifdetelli, and in Turkey as Kıbrıs Çiftetellisi, arranged and played with a contemporary interpretation by Ahmet Akarsu, who is a self-educated musician from Nicosia, N. Cyprus.
Ahmet has been playing Cypriot folk music with violin for several folk dance groups in Cyprus since 1987. He learned playing the accordion by himself. He also plays the ud, accordion, kaval and darbuka...
